Summary

TNF-α (17.5 kDa, 157 amino acid) is a non-glycosylated protein that is a potent lymphoid factor, which exerts cytotoxic effects on a wide range of tumor cells and other target cells. It is secreted by macrophages, monocytes, neutrophils, T-cells and NK-cells following their stimulation by bacterial lipopolysaccha­rides. TNF-α has been suggested to play a pro-inflammatory role and has been detected in synovial fluid of patients with rheumatoid arthritis.
